As a remainder, abstracts for the X Conference of the Italian Association for the History of Economic Thought (AISPE) are due next week (November 1).

Is it possible to develop economic theories maintaining a moral vision of society? Can the "just" and the "good" be combined with the "true"? To what extent is the growth of scientifically analyzable social phenomena compatible with notions acquired by faith? The organizing committee wishes to stimulate reflection on and research into the importance of the various visions of the values, rights and dignity of man in determining the evolution of economic science, both by playing the role of critic and by promoting new concepts or indicating more appropriate research methods.

The X Conference of AISPE will be held on March 27-29, 2008 at Treviso, Italy.

Abstracts (max 500 words) must be submitted by 1 November 2007 to Stefano Solari by e-mail: [log in to unmask]

All information concerning the Conference are posted on the website: http://www.giuri.unipd.it/~AISPE-2008/
